Effects of injecting systemic insecticides into mango during off season on the mango hopper population.

Abstract : Field studies were carried out in mango plantations in Dharwad, India, to determine the effect of injecting dimethoate 30 EC and phosphamidon 100 EC into stems at 0.3, 0.4 and 0.5 ml a.i./cm girth of the tree to control Amritodus atkinsoni, Idioscopus niveosparsus and I. clypealis. The insecticides were injected once during the 4th week of August. Dimethoate at 0.5 ml a.i. gave 100% control for 3 weeks, and in general, all treatments gave at least 90% control for up to 8 weeks.
